Sauli buses proprietor Solomon dies in accident

COAST REGION : Sauli buses proprietor, Solomon Sauli Mwalabila has died in a car crash at Miwaleni, Mlandizi in Coast Region today at around 12:30 am.
Confriming the accident Coast Regional Police Commander ACP Pius Lutumo said the accident involved multiple vehicles at the same location.
In the course, a Fuso truck with registration number T213 DQD experienced a mechanical failure and collided with the Jeep, T466 EGW, in which the Sauli was traveling.
The Jeep then hit another vehicle, a Howo truck hauling gravel to yet to be confirmed destination.

The late Sauli, a resident of Mbeya, was accompanied by his four-year-old child who sustained minor injuries and was taken to the hospital before being discharged.
The body of the deceased has been preserved at the Mlandizi Health Cente’s mortuary.
Sauli was the owner of Sauli buses, which used to operate routes between Dar Es Salaam and Mbeya.
